AI Interaction Architect
Designing the structural logic and interface paradigms for human interaction with artificial intelligence systems.
Overview
The AI Interaction Architect functions at the intersection of systems design and cognitive psychology, focusing on how complex computational processes are presented to humans. The daily rhythm involves mapping out decision trees, defining prompt engineering strategies, and prototyping multi-modal interfaces that handle non-linear interactions. It is a role characterized by the resolution of ambiguity, as the professional must anticipate unpredictable AI behaviors and create guardrails that maintain a consistent logic across the system.
Success in this career requires a deep understanding of both high-level software architecture and the nuances of human communication. The work is often intellectual and iterative, involving the translation of abstract technical constraints into practical design patterns. Those who thrive in this position tend to possess a high degree of systems thinking and the ability to maintain a bird's-eye view of complex technical ecosystems while ensuring granular interface details are precise and functional.
Responsibilities
- Define the logical frameworks and interaction models for generative AI and machine learning applications.
- Develop standardized prompt libraries and response patterns to ensure consistent AI behavior across different platforms.
- Collaborate with data scientists to optimize model outputs based on human-centered design principles.
- Establish ethical guidelines and safety protocols for automated decision-making processes.
- Create comprehensive documentation for interaction flows and system logic to guide engineering implementation.
- Evaluate the effectiveness of AI-driven interfaces through quantitative performance metrics and qualitative feedback analysis.
Qualifications
- A graduate degree in Human-Computer Interaction, Cognitive Science, or a related technical field.
- Extensive experience in UX architecture or systems design within a machine learning context.
- Proficiency in technical prototyping tools and programming languages such as Python or JavaScript.
- Demonstrated expertise in large language model integration and prompt engineering.
- Strong understanding of information architecture and complex system mapping.

Frequently asked questions
What does an AI Interaction Architect do?
An AI Interaction Architect defines the logic and interface patterns for sophisticated artificial intelligence and machine learning systems. They bridge the gap between complex algorithmic processing and human-centered design to ensure seamless, intuitive interactions. Their work focuses on structuring how AI models present information and respond to user inputs.
What skills are needed for an AI Interaction Architect?
Proficiency in user experience (UX) design and human-computer interaction is essential for this role. Architects must possess a deep understanding of machine learning principles, conversational AI design, and data flow logic. Strong analytical skills and experience with prototyping tools help them build functional frameworks for AI-driven software.
What is the career path for an AI Interaction Architect?
Professionals often begin in UX design, software engineering, or data science before specializing in machine learning interfaces. The career path typically leads to senior roles such as Lead AI Strategist or Head of Interaction Design. Continued advancement involves overseeing enterprise-level AI ecosystems and pioneering new standards for human-AI collaboration.
